Primary Objectives
The Dental Hygienist-PRN is a key line-level position responsible for performing advanced prophylactic and preventive dental procedures in the treatment of patients with related medical and dental problems. Essential Functions
- Performs oral prophylaxis, root planning, CPITN probing, applies topical fluorides and pit and fissure sealants, and bacterial exams
- Takes digital X-rays
- Serves as Health Promotions Disease Prevention Coordinator for the PCI Dental Clinic
- Provides oral hygiene instructions and counseling to patients about good nutrition and its impact toward oral health
- Explains to patients the causes of periodontal disease and tooth decay
- Establishes and monitors an appointment and recall system
- Assists in planning, coordination and evaluating community oral health programs
- Assists the Dentist in quality assessment and oral health resources management
- Maintains accurate records of all persons receiving care performed by dental hygienist
- Sterilizes and disinfects dental instruments and materials and cleans equipment on a weekly basis. Assists in maintaining logs for cleaning instrument sterilization

Job Requirements
- Must be a graduate of a School of Dental Hygiene, which has been approved by the Board of Dental Examiners of Alabama
- Must possess and maintain current licensure to practice Dental Hygiene in the State of Alabama or must possess current licensure in another state and obtain licensure to practice Dental Hygiene in the State of Alabama within one (1) year from date of hire
- Must maintain current professional licensure in Basic Life Support (BLS) or obtain licensure within ninety (90) days of date of hire in position
- Must possess certification of “Mandatory Reporter Training” or obtain certification during the first week of employment
- Two (2) years experience as a licensed Dental Hygienist is required
